Featured on AutoHunter, the online auction platform driven by ClassicCars.com, is a 1968 Fiat 500.
“This restored 1968 Fiat 500F coupe is finished in gray with a black fold-back canvas roof over a red and white vinyl interior that features front bucket seats and a rear bench,” AutoHunter notes in the listing.
The original air-cooled 499cc 2-cylinder engine is paired with a 4-speed manual transmission. In September 2021 this Fiat was upgraded with a repaired fuel tank, cleansed fuse box contacts, updated wiring for the exterior lights and received a 70-point inspection.
The car rides on 12-inch wheels highlighted by chrome hubcaps and Pirelli Cinturato tires.
Inside the Fia,t red front buckets seats are complemented with white piping and accent panels. The spartan interior has manual crank windows with front quarter vents windows, floor-mounted manual shifter, and a Veglia Borletti S.p.A 120-kph speedometer.
This car is being offered by the selling dealer with Italian and German documentation, and a clear Florida title.
